broke what record?

F-15s have taken damage or been downed by SAMs before.
>>
>>34027245
No F-15 has been shot down in air to air combat. F-15s have only been shotdown by ground fire or SAMs.

>>34032319
The Su-27 family doesn't really have much of a record since they've practically never seen real air combat.

The only claimed kills by Su-27s were two to four MiG-29s when Ethiopia and Eritrea were at war with each other.
